Abstract

Dental caries is a very complex disease affecting people worldwide. Its incidence is witnessing a decline in developed countries due to proper availability of fluoride products, better oral health services, and awareness regarding etiology of caries. To apply measures which can prevent or control caries , DMFT indexes are used which is one of the most important quantitative factors, in measuring tooth caries level of an individual.The aim of the present study was to determine association between DMFT score and gender in adult patients who reported to a Private hospital in Chennai. An institutional record based study was done to assess the association between gender and caries experience in outpatients.The study was carried out on an one-year period,  (June 2019 to April 2020) on a total of 4643 patients ( 2541 males and 2102 females) records which were analysed for DMFT index. The results obtained were analysed through SPSS software. From the results obtained the DMFT score of 8-14 was found highest among 44.2 % patients. DMFT score of 0-7 was highest in males compared to females. DMFT scores of 8-14, 15-21 and 22- 28 were highest in females compared to males. (p value = >0.05).The study concludes that higher caries experience was found among females than males but the study was insignificant..
